> 1. Is anyone else seeing this issue?
No. The underlying four-letter code for inches in Illustrator is e182, which is
also the underlying code for bicubic automatic in Photoshop. I don't suppose
you have a 'use application "Adobe Photoshop CC 2017"' statement in there
somewhere? Otherwise my first suggestion would be to clear your dictionary
caches in Script Debugger.
> 2. Can I expect "preserve details" to be a consistent and valid substitution
> for "points" in Illustrator's terminology?
Assuming the problem persists, yes — as long as you save it compiled. The
compiled version contains only the underlying code.
But I'd be thinking about solving the problem first.
